The froghopper (philaenus spumarius), the champion leaper of the insect world, has a mass of 12.3 mg. it can leave the ground with a speed as high as 4.0 m/s in the vertical direction. the jump itself lasts a mere 1.0 ms before the insect is clear of the ground. assuming constant acceleration, find the force that the ground exerts on the froghopper during its jump.
